S2. Ans.(d)
Sol. Webster’s method is used for determining optimum signal cycle length (C_O) and it is given by according to Webster’s method–

▭(C_O=(1.5L+5)/(1-Y))
L = Total lost time in a cycle length
Y = sum of critical flow rate for all phases

S3. Ans.(b)
Sol. Given, volume of diluted sample = 300 ml.
Initial volume of test sample = 2 ml.
Initial dissolved oxygen (DOi)= 8 mg/l
Final dissolved oxygen (DO_F)= 2 mg/l.
▭(BOD=(DOi-DO_F )×Dilution factor)
Dilution factor = (volume of diluted sample)/(Initial volume of test sample)
= 300/2
= 150
BOD= (8-2) ×150
= 900 mg/l.

S4. Ans.(c)
Sol. porosity (n) = 1/3
G = 2.5
Critical hydraulic gradient (i_c) =?
e = n/(1-n )=(1\/3)/(2\/3)=0.5
▭(e=0.5)
i_c=(G-1)/(1+e)=(2.5-1)/(1+0.5)=1.5/1.5
▭(i_c=1 )

S9. Ans.(c)
Sol. Peak flood discharge given by Dicken formula-
Q=CA^(3/4)
Where Q= Peak flood discharge (m³/sec)
C= Dicken’s coefficient
A= Area in km²
Now given C= 16, A= 180 km²
Then Q= 16 (180)3/4
Q= 786.27 m³/sec

S10. Ans.(a)
Sol. u=-dψ/dy
u=-d/dy [x^3-y^3 ]= 3y^2
u (1,-1)= 3(-1)^2= 3
v=dψ/dx= d/dx [x^3-y^3 )= 3x^2
v(1,-1)=3(1)^2= 3
V=√(u^2+v^2 )
= √(3^2+3^2 )
=4.24

S11. Ans.(a)
Sol. Malleability is the property of material allows it to expand in all direction without rupture or it is the property of a material by virtue of which it can be beaten or rolled into plates.

S12. Ans.(a)
Sol. Maximum stress inside thin cylinder.
σ_ind= Pd/2t
180 = (9×500)/2t
t = 12.5 mm
